Overview

The Jolie Mineral Sheer Tint SPF 20 Moisturizer is Jolie Cosmetics' answer to the growing demand for low-effort, multi-tasking daily wear — combining light coverage, hydration, and sun protection into a single step. At a mid-range price, it sits comfortably between drugstore options and prestige tinted moisturizers, making it worth considering if you're ready to simplify your morning routine. The formula is oil-free and water-based, designed for adults who want their skin to look better without feeling like they're wearing makeup. It's made in the USA and carries a clean beauty philosophy, skipping parabens, fragrance, talc, and a long list of other commonly avoided ingredients. The one available shade, Sun Glow, leans warm — something to factor in before buying.

Features & Benefits

What makes this tinted moisturizer genuinely useful on a daily basis is how it handles multiple concerns without the weight. The mineral SPF 20 offers broad spectrum UVA and UVB protection — solid for everyday errands and commutes, though if you're spending extended time outdoors, a dedicated sunscreen is still worth layering. The hydration claim is ambitious for an oil-free formula, and buyers with dry skin will want to pay attention to how it performs through the afternoon. Coverage is intentionally sheer — it softens redness and evens out texture rather than masking it. The non-pore-clogging formula is also free from fragrance and alcohol, which tends to make a real difference for skin that reacts easily to conventional makeup products.

Best For

This SPF moisturizer was clearly built with the minimalist in mind — someone who wants to get out the door without juggling a multi-step routine. It works particularly well for people with sensitive or acne-prone skin who have had bad experiences with fragrance-heavy or oil-based formulas. If you are in the habit of wearing heavy foundation daily and you are looking for something lighter, this is a reasonable starting point for that shift. The shade situation is worth flagging: Sun Glow suits warm to medium tones most naturally, so if your complexion runs fair or cool-toned, results may vary. This is a weekday, run-around option — not something you would reach for when longer-lasting or more precise coverage is expected.

User Feedback

Buyers who have incorporated the Jolie sheer tint into their daily routine frequently highlight how weightless it feels on skin, even after a full day — no greasy residue, no midday heaviness. Several users with combination or oily skin report it holds up reasonably well through normal daily activity. On the flip side, the lack of shade variety is a consistent sticking point in reviews, with some buyers noting that Sun Glow can pull orange or ashy depending on their undertone. A handful of users also question whether the tube size justifies the price for daily use. Hydration performance draws mixed opinions, particularly from those with very dry skin who found the moisturizing effect less impressive than advertised.

Suitable for:

The Jolie Mineral Sheer Tint SPF 20 Moisturizer was built for people who want their morning routine to be short, clean, and effective — and who are comfortable trading full coverage for a more natural, skin-forward look. It is a strong fit for adults with oily, combination, or sensitive skin who have struggled to find a daily hybrid that does not irritate or clog pores, especially since it skips fragrance, oil, alcohol, and over a dozen other commonly reactive ingredients. People actively moving away from heavy foundation — whether for comfort, skin health, or simply lifestyle preference — will find the sheer, translucent finish a refreshing change. It also appeals strongly to clean beauty shoppers who read labels carefully and want vegan, cruelty-free products made in the USA. The Sun Glow shade works best on warm to medium skin tones looking for a subtle, natural-looking finish on low-key days rather than anything corrective or evening-out.

Not suitable for:

Buyers expecting meaningful coverage should look elsewhere — this tinted moisturizer is intentionally sheer, and it will not conceal blemishes, deeper discoloration, or uneven skin tone in any significant way. The single available shade is a genuine limitation; if your complexion is fair, deep, or cool-toned, the Sun Glow formula may pull off or simply not blend naturally into your skin. The SPF 20 rating, while useful for incidental daily sun exposure, is not adequate protection for anyone spending extended time outdoors — this is not a substitute for a proper broad-spectrum sunscreen at the beach or during outdoor activity. People with very dry skin may also find the hydration falls short of expectations, particularly in harsh or low-humidity climates. In short, the Jolie Mineral Sheer Tint SPF 20 Moisturizer is not the right tool if your needs lean toward coverage, sun safety in high-exposure conditions, or shade-matching flexibility.

Specifications

  • Product Type: This is a 3-in-1 tinted moisturizer that combines light coverage, daily hydration, and broad spectrum mineral sun protection in a single formula.
  • SPF Rating: Formulated with SPF 20 broad spectrum mineral sunscreen that protects against both UVA and UVB rays during everyday exposure.
  • Sun Filter Type: Uses a mineral-based sunscreen filter rather than a chemical one, making it less likely to cause irritation on sensitive or reactive skin.
  • Coverage Level: Provides sheer, translucent coverage designed to even out skin tone subtly rather than mask or conceal blemishes or deeper pigmentation.
  • Finish: Delivers a natural, second-skin finish that avoids the cakey or creased appearance often associated with heavier foundation formulas.
  • Formula Base: Water-based and oil-free formula designed to hydrate skin without contributing to shine or clogging pores throughout the day.
  • Hydration Claim: The manufacturer states the formula provides up to 24 hours of hydration, though results will vary depending on skin type and climate.
  • Shade: Available in a single shade, Sun Glow, which is a warm-toned translucent tint best suited to warm and medium complexions.
  • Volume: Each tube contains approximately 1.76 oz (roughly 52ml) of product, packaged in a slim tube measuring 1 x 1 x 5.8 inches.
  • Free From: Formulated without gluten, parabens, phthalates, fragrance, oil, sulfates, GMOs, alcohol, synthetic dyes, or talc.
  • Skin Type: Marketed as suitable for all skin types, with a non-comedogenic formula that is particularly well-suited to oily, combination, and sensitive skin.
  • Vegan Status: The formula is fully vegan and cruelty-free, with no animal-derived ingredients and no animal testing at any stage of production.
  • Origin: Manufactured in the United States by Jolie Cosmetics, also operating under the brand name Jolie Impeccable Me.
  • Age Range: Intended for adult use, with no specific age sub-range indicated beyond a general adult designation by the manufacturer.
  • Special Feature: The lightweight texture is a core design priority, ensuring the product does not feel heavy or occlusive during daily wear.
